Simon makes a model of a boat, using a scale of 1 : 30
If the model has a height of 40 cm, find the height of the real boat.
Give your answer in metres.
Answer: 12 metres
Step-by-step explanation:
The scale factor used for the model is 1 : 30.
This means that for any 1cm on the model, the real boat would be 30 cm.
If the height is 40 cm on the model, the real boat will be 30 times that:
= 40 * 30
= 1,200 cm
A metre is equivalent to 100cm.
1,200 cm would therefore be:
= 1,200/100
= 12 metres

How do you Multiply Radicals?????
Answer:
1. [tex]4\sqrt{5}[/tex]
2. [tex]10\sqrt{10}[/tex]
Step-by-step explanation:
When you multiply radicals, you do the following
[tex]a\sqrt{b}\cdot c\sqrt{d}\\\\=ac\sqrt{bd}[/tex]
with that in mind
1.
[tex]\sqrt{16}\cdot \sqrt{5}[/tex]
here we don't need to multiply 16 times 5, because 16 = 4^2 and take the square root of it, gives you 4
[tex]=4\sqrt{5}[/tex]
2.
[tex]\sqrt{20}\cdot 5\sqrt{2}\\\\\longrightarrow 20 = 2^2\cdot 5\\\\=2\sqrt{5}\cdot5\sqrt{2}\\\\=(2\cdot5)\sqrt{5\cdot2}\\\\=10\sqrt{10}[/tex]

first three terms of a sequence are given. Round to the nearest thousand (if necessary) 152,149,146... Find the 30th term
Answer:
65
Step-by-step explanation:
use the following equation
aₙ=a₁+(n-1)d
Where d is the common difference
n is the term
a₁ is the first term
the common difference is -3 (149-152)
this means we have
152+(30-1)*-3
Compute this and get
65

How many solutions exist for the given equation 12x + 1 = 3(4x + 1) -2
Answer:
All real numbers are solutions (hope that helps)
Step-by-step explanation:
12x+1=3(4x+1)−2
Step 1: Simplify both sides of the equation.
12x+1=3(4x+1)−2
12x+1=(3)(4x)+(3)(1)+−2(Distribute)
12x+1=12x+3+−2
12x+1=(12x)+(3+−2)(Combine Like Terms)
12x+1=12x+1
12x+1=12x+1
Step 2: Subtract 12x from both sides.
12x+1−12x=12x+1−12x
1=1
Step 3: Subtract 1 from both sides.
1−1=1−1
0=0

In which quadrant does 694 lie?
Answer: C. quadrant l
Step-by-step explanation:
Angle 694° lies Quadrant IV which is correct option (D)
What is a graph?A graph can be defined as a pictorial representation or a diagram that represents data or values
What is the quadrant?A quadrant is defined as an area contained by the x and y axes, which there are four quadrants in a graph.
For Quadrant I : the value of x and y both are positive ( +,+ )
For Quadrant II : the value of x is negative and y is positive ( -,+ )
For Quadrant III : the value of x is negative and y is negative ( -, - )
For Quadrant IV : the value of x is positive and y is negative ( +, - )
Locate the quadrant of the angle.
If the angle is greater than 360°,
Subtract 360° until the angle is less than 360°.
⇒ 694 - 360
⇒ 334°
Hence, angle 694° lies Quadrant IV
